.logo
{
	background-image: url(images/logo.gif);
	width: 978px;
	height: 138px;
}
h1
{
	padding: 10px 0 10px 0;
	color : #9c9c9c;
	font-size : 16px;
	font-family : Tahoma,Verdana,Arial;
	margin: 0 0 10px 0;
	border-bottom: solid 1px #9c9c9c;
}
th {
	color : #000000;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
}
input, select {
	color : #000000;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: normal;
}
.header
{
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
	font-size : 16px;
	color : #666;
	vertical-align: top;	
}
.px {
	padding-top : 0px;
	padding-bottom : 0px;
	padding-left : 0px;
	padding-right : 0px;
	margin-top : 2px;
	margin-bottom : 0px;
	margin-left : 0px;
	margin-right : 0px;
}
.px5 {
	padding-top : 0px;
	padding-bottom : 0px;
	padding-left : 0px;
	padding-right : 0px;
	margin-top : 5px;
	margin-bottom : 0px;
	margin-left : 0px;
	margin-right : 0px;
}
.title01 {
	color : #FFFFFF;
	margin-top : 10px;
	padding-bottom : 10px;
	margin-bottom : 0px;
	margin-left : 15px;
	margin-right : 15px;
	font-size : 13px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
	font-style: italic;
}
.title {
	color : #FFFFFF;
	margin-top : 1px;
	padding-bottom : 1px;
	margin-bottom : 1px;
	margin-left : 37px;
	margin-right : 15px;
	font-size : 10px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
}
.title a {
	color : #EF6D00;
}
.title a:hover {
	color : #C25A02;
}
.list {
	color : #FFFFFF;
	margin-top : 3px;
	padding-bottom : 3px;
	margin-bottom : 0px;
	margin-left : 10px;
	margin-right : 10px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
}
.right {
	color : #000000;
	margin-top : 5px;
	padding-bottom : 10px;
	margin-bottom : 0px;
	margin-left : 15px;
	margin-right : 15px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
}
.right a, .list a {
	color : #FF7500;
}
.right a:hover {
	color : #AAAAAA;
}
.left {
	color : #000000;
	margin-top : 5px;
	padding-bottom : 5px;
	margin-bottom : 0px;
	margin-left : 15px;
	margin-right : 25px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
}
.left b {
	color : #FF6600;
}
.left a {
	color : #FF6600;
}
.left a:hover {
	color : #FF0000;
}

.menuadm {
	color : #000000;
	margin-top : 1px;
	padding-bottom : 1px;
	margin-bottom : 0px;
	margin-left : 10px;
	margin-right : 10px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	text-align: right;
}
.menu01 {
	color : #000000;
	margin-top : 1px;
	padding-bottom : 1px;
	margin-bottom : 0px;
	margin-left : 10px;
	margin-right : 10px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
}
.menu01 a {
	color : #000000;
	text-decoration: none;
}
.menu01 a:hover {
	color : #555555;
}
.menu02adm {
	color : #FFFFFF;
	margin-top : 5px;
	padding-bottom : 5px;
	margin-bottom : 0px;
	margin-left : 20px;
	margin-right : 20px;
	font-size : 11px;
	padding-left: 90px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
	text-align:center;
}

.menu02 {
	color : #FFFFFF;
	margin-top : 5px;
	padding-bottom : 5px;
	margin-bottom : 0px;
	margin-left : 20px;
	margin-right : 20px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
}
.menu02 a {
	color : #FFFFFF;
	text-decoration: none;
}
.menu02 a:hover {
	color : #DDDDDD;
}
.bar01 {
	color: #000000;
	margin-top: 1px;
	padding-bottom: 1px;
	margin-bottom: 0px;
	margin-left: 5px;
	margin-right: 20px;
	font-size: 18px;
	font-family: Arial,Tahoma,Verdana;
	font-weight: bold;
}
.b01 {
	color : #000000;
	margin-top : 2px;
	padding-bottom : 1px;
	margin-bottom : 1px;
	margin-left : 20px;
	margin-right : 15px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
}
.b01 a {
	color : #000000;
	text-decoration: none;
}
.b01 a:hover {
	color : #333333;
}

.fon_top01
{
	background-image: url(images/fon_top01.gif);
}
.fon_top02
{
	background-image: url(images/form03.gif);
}
.fon_left03
{
	background-image: url(images/fon_left03.gif);
}
.fon_left01
{
	background-image: url(images/fon_left01.gif);
}
.fon_left02
{
	background-image: url(images/fon_left02.gif);
}
.left01
{	
	background-image: url(images/left01.gif);
}
.left02
{
	background-image: url(images/left02.gif);
}
.bot
{
	background-image: url(images/bot.gif);
}

.submenuitems
{
	font-size : 10px;
	font-family : Tahoma,Verdana,Arial;
	padding: 5px 15px 5px 15px;
	font-weight: bold;
	color: #fff;
}

.welcome_message
{
	color : #fff;	
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	font-weight: bold;
	
}

.submenuitems a { font-family: Verdana; font-size: 10px; font-weight: bold; color:#fff; }
.submenuitems a:link {text-decoration: none;}
.submenuitems a:visited { text-decoration: none;}
.submenuitems a:hover { text-decoration: none; }
.submenuitems a:active { text-decoration: none;} 

/* Begin Menu Style */
.menustyle 
{ 
	background-color:#fff;	
	width:137px;
	margin-right: 10px;
}
.menuitem 
{ 
	color : #000000;
	margin-top : 2px;
	padding-bottom : 1px;
	margin-bottom : 1px;
	margin-left : 20px;
	margin-right : 15px;
	font-size : 11px;
	font-family : Tahoma,Verdana,Arial;
	cursor:hand; 
	border-bottom: solid 1px #e6e6e6;	
	padding: 4px 0 2px 0;
}
.mouseup 
{ 
	width:150px;
	background-color:#dbd9d9;
	color:white;
	font-family:verdana;
	font-size:10pt;
	padding:2px;
	padding-left:5px;
	padding-right:15px;
	border:1px;
	border-color:#3F3F3F;
	border-style:solid;
	cursor:hand; 
}
.mouseover 
{ 
	width:150px;
	background-color:#666666;
	color:white;
	font-family:verdana;
	font-size:10pt;
	padding:2px;
	padding-left:5px;
	padding-right:15px;
	border:1px;
	border-color:#3F3F3F;
	border-left-color:#8A99BA;
	border-top-color:#8A99BA;
	border-right-color:black;
	border-bottom-color:black;
	border-style:ridge;
	cursor:hand; }
.mousedown 
{ 
	width:150px;
	background-color:#928c8d;
	color:white;
	font-family:verdana;
	font-size:10pt;
	padding:2px;
	padding-left:5px;
	padding-right:15px;
	border:1px;
	border-color:#3F3F3F;
	border-right-color:#8A99BA;
	border-bottom-color:#8A99BA;
	border-left-color:black
	;border-top-color:black;
	border-style:solid;
	cursor:hand; 
}
/* End Menu Style */

/* Login Form */
.LoginLabel
{
	color: #005b8e;
	font-family: Verdana;
	font-size: 10px;
}	

/* End Login Form */

/* Content */
#Wrapper 
{ 
	Color: Red; 
	padding: 10px 20px 20px 20px;
	font-family:Verdana;
}

#Wrapper P
{ 
	font-weight: normal;
	font-family: Verdana;
	font-size: 11px;
	color: #666;
}

#Wrapper H1
{ 
	Color: #999; 
	padding: 10px 0 0 0;
	font-weight: bold;
	font-family: Verdana;
	font-size: 12px;
}
.footer
{
	font-weight: normal;
	font-family: Verdana;
	font-size: 11px;
	color: #666;
}

.topspace
{
	height: 10px;
	line-height: 5px;
}

.leftcenter
{
	background-image: url(images/leftcenter.gif);
	background-repeat: repeat-y;
}

.leftcenterspace100
{
	background-image: url(images/leftcenter.gif);
	background-repeat: repeat-y;
	height: 100px;
	line-height: 100px;
}

.loginbody
{
	background-image: url(images/loginbody.gif);
	background-repeat: repeat-y;
	padding: 5px 30px 5px 10px;
	
}

.content
{
	font-family: Verdana; 
	font-size: 10px;
	font-weight: normal; 
}

.topmenubg
{
	background-image: url(images/topmenubg.gif);
	background-repeat: repeat-x;
	width: 978px;
	height: 33px;
}

.menuvisited
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: bold; 
	color:#fff; 	
	width: 158px; 
	height: 20px; 
	min-height: 20px; 
	margin-bottom: 1px; 
	padding: 3px 0 0 5px; 
	display: block;
	text-decoration: none;
	background: #5c6e87 url(images/left_menu_pink.gif) repeat-y;
}

a.category-nav-link { font-family: Verdana; font-size: 10px; font-weight: bold; color:#fff; background: #5c6e87 url(images/left_menu_grey.gif) repeat-y; width: 158px; height: 20px; min-height: 20px; margin-bottom: 1px; padding: 3px 0 0 5px; display: block;}
a.category-nav-link:link {text-decoration: none;}
a.category-nav-link:visited { text-decoration: none;}
a.category-nav-link:hover { text-decoration: none; background: #5c6e87 url(images/left_menu_pink_over.gif) repeat-y; }
a.category-nav-link:active { text-decoration: none;background: #5c6e87 url(images/left_menu_pink.gif) repeat-y;} 

.alternateProduct
{
	border-left: dotted 1px #666;
	border-right: dotted 1px #666;
	border-bottom: solid 0 #000;
}

.product-name
{
	font-family: Verdana; 
	font-size: 12px; 
	font-weight: bold; 
	color:#999; 	
}

.product-price
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: bold; 
	color:#00a2df; 	
}

.product-quantity
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: bold; 
	color:#666; 	
	border-bottom: solid 1px #666; 
	border-top: solid 1px #666; 
	background: #ccc; 
	padding: 5px 20px 5px 20px; 
	vertical-align: top;	
}

.product-details
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: normal; 
	color:#9c9c9c; 	
	padding-top: 30px;
}

.product-warning
{
	font-family: Verdana; 
	font-size: 9px; 
	font-weight: normal; 
	color:#f00;
	font-style:italic;
	padding-top: 5px;
}

.viewcartheader
{
	font-weight:bold;
}

/*---------- Cart Summary Styles ---------------*/

.Summary-Qty-Label
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: bold; 
	color:#9c9c9c; 	
	text-align: left;
	
}

.Summary-Price-Label
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: bold; 
	color:#9c9c9c; 	
	text-align: right;
	
}

.Summary-Qty
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: normal; 
	color:#9c9c9c; 	
	text-align: left;
	
}

.Summary-Price
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: normal; 
	color:#9c9c9c; 	
	text-align: right;
	
}

.CartSummaryLink
{
	font-family: Verdana; 
	font-size: 10px; 
	font-weight: normal;
	color:#9c9c9c;
}

a.CartSummaryLink { text-decoration:none; color:#9c9c9c;}
a.CartSummaryLink:link { text-decoration:none; color:#9c9c9c;}
a.CartSummaryLink:visited { text-decoration:none; color:#9c9c9c;}
a.CartSummaryLink:active { text-decoration:none; color:#9c9c9c;}
a.CartSummaryLink:hover { text-decoration:underline; color:#9c9c9c;}
/*---------- Cart Summary Form ------------------*/
